Summary: The reasons for the "contrived" priest shortage - and more!
Comment: In an informative and well-written book, Michael Rose has given what is, to date, the best reasons for the present priesthood crisis.

The author claims that the reason we have a shortage of priests (at least, in many dioceses) is because for many years qualified candidates in those dioceses have been turned away. He claims that those who hold true to the authentic magisterial teachings of Holy Mother Church are, in those places, rejected in favor of men who oppose Her, especially in teachings concerning homosexuality, celibacy, an all-male priesthood, divorce, and contraception. This predictably has resulted in scandals, heterodox teachings from the pulpit, and less reverence in our houses of worship and in our liturgies.

He further claims that the reason qualified candidates are rejected is because those who would want to overthrow Holy Mother Church have made their way into powerful positions in many (but certainly not all) dioceses and seminaries, including many bishops. These people have in turn become "gatekeepers"; filtering out the qualified candidates and welcoming the unqualified. The stories that some of his interviewees tell about what goes on in heterodox seminaries are incredible.
